Cross-Rate
The implicit exchange rate between two currencies (usually non-U.S.) quoted in some third currency (usually the U.S. dollar).
Exchange Rate
The worth of a certain currency depicted through the value of a different currency.
Foreign Currency Approach
A method in international finance that involves analyzing business or investment decisions based on their impact in foreign currency terms.
Inflation Rate
The increase in the average price levels of goods and services, resulting in reduced purchasing capacity.
